Electromagnetic shielding rubber as well as preparation method thereof and electronic device
An electromagnetic shielding and rubber technology, which is applied in the field of electromagnetic shielding rubber and its preparation, can solve the problems of poor interface bonding and the mechanical properties of the rubber substrate, and achieve the effect of improving the processing technology performance.

Embodiment 1
[0047] Electromagnetic shielding rubber formula composition: 100 parts by weight of styrene-butadiene rubber, 2 parts by weight of stearic acid, 10 parts by weight of carbon nanotubes, 10 parts by weight of graphene, 20 parts by weight of acetylene black, 50 parts by weight of silver powder, 30 parts by weight of copper powder, 20 parts by weight of silver-plated glass beads, 30 parts by weight of silver-plated nickel powder, 20 parts by weight of nickel powder, 20 parts by weight of iron oxide and 25 parts by weight of nickel oxide;
[0048] The method for preparing electromagnetic shielding material:
[0049] (1) mixing styrene-butadiene rubber and stearic acid at 60 degrees Celsius for 5 minutes to obtain the mixing material;

Embodiment 2
[0053] Electromagnetic shielding rubber formula composition: 100 parts by weight of silicone rubber, 2 parts by weight of oxidizing agent, 1 part by weight of stearic acid, 8 parts by weight of carbon nanotubes, 7 parts by weight of graphene, 10 parts by weight of acetylene black, 20 parts by weight The silver powder of parts by weight, the copper powder of 40 parts by weight, the silver-plated glass microsphere of 30 parts by weight, the silver-plated nickel powder of 20 parts by weight, the nickel powder of 30 parts by weight, the iron oxide of 40 parts by weight and the nickel oxide of 20 parts by weight ;
[0054] The method for preparing electromagnetic shielding material:
[0055] (1) mixing silicone rubber with stearic acid and an oxidizing agent at 60 degrees Celsius for 20 minutes to obtain a mixing material;

Embodiment 3
[0059] Electromagnetic shielding rubber formula composition: 100 parts by weight of nitrile rubber, 1 part by weight of stearic acid, 2 parts by weight of antioxidant, 3 parts by weight of carbon nanotubes, 3 parts by weight of graphene, 10 parts by weight of acetylene black , 70 parts by weight of silver powder, 20 parts by weight of copper powder, 40 parts by weight of silver-plated glass beads, 60 parts by weight of silver-plated nickel powder, 80 parts by weight of nickel powder, 100 parts by weight of iron oxide and 40 parts by weight of Nickel oxide;
[0060] The method for preparing electromagnetic shielding material:
[0061] (1) mixing nitrile rubber with stearic acid and anti-aging agent for 10 minutes at 70 degrees Celsius to obtain the mixing material;
